Recap: Clover Blue Eagles vs. Gaffney Indians

The Clover Blue Eagles's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Wednesday after their third straight loss. They took a 60-54 hit to the loss column at the hands of Gaffney. The result shouldn't come as a shock considering that's the fewest points Clover has scored all season.

Clover's loss came despite a true team effort from the offense,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Jaylon Hoover, who scored 13 points. Another player making a difference was Hunter Decuir, who scored 12 points.

Clover's loss dropped their record down to 2-4. As for Gaffney, they pushed their record up to 5-2 with that win, which was their third straight at home.

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Clover will be home for the holidays to greet York at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. The matchup should be an exciting one, as these teams are ranked near one another in South Carolina (York is ranked 140th, while Clover is ranked 153rd). Gaffney will be home for the holidays to greet Riverside at 7:30 p.m. on Friday.
